From c4c6e9d2e9ccaa570ad1cf1afbd88b052ddfb74a Mon Sep 17 00:00:00 2001 From: ZomoXYZ Date: Thu, 26 May 2022 20:57:59 -0500 Subject: [PATCH] optional type specification --- src/storageclass.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/storageclass.ts b/src/storageclass.ts index 4a198cc..a900199 100644 --- a/src/storageclass.ts +++ b/src/storageclass.ts @@ -23,7 +23,7 @@ export class StorageBase { return this.val.get() } - getJson(defaultValue?: T): T | {} { + getJson(defaultValue?: T): T { try { let val = JSON.parse(this.val.get()) @@ -38,7 +38,7 @@ export class StorageBase { return defaultValue } - return {} + return {} as T } }